Metabolic and Cellular Function Antioxidant and Anti-inflammatory Actions Unlike saturated fats that promote oxidative stress, the antioxidants in extra virgin oil neutralize free radicals at the cellular level. Impact on Cardiovascular Health Scientific literature consistently associates the Mediterranean diet, centered around this oil, with reduced rates of heart disease.

The consumption of high-quality oil stimulates the production of bile and pancreatic enzymes, aiding in the emulsification and absorption of fat-soluble vitamins. Incorporating one to two tablespoons daily into a balanced diet can provide a significant boost to overall nutrient intake without disrupting caloric goals.
